Flora Saini is one of the popular faces in Bollywood. She has featured in various Hindi, Kannada and Tamil.  The actress opened up about facing sexual harassment by her ex-boyfriend. The actress recalled the domestic violence and sexual harassment she suffered in 2007 about which she had first spoken publicly in 2018 during the MeToo movement.
 

In his interview, Flora said she left her home to live with film producer and her former boyfriend Gaurang Doshi as he asked her to prove her love for him. The actor further spoke about the recent murder of Shraddha Walkar, who was allegedly killed by her boyfriend and live-in partner Aftab Poonawala in Delhi. The actress said, “Your parents see the red flags. In Shraddha’s case as well, the same happened. They first cut you out from your family. I also left my home, and within a week of moving in with him, I was being bashed up. I couldn’t understand why he was beating me up suddenly, because in my eyes he was a really nice guy.”

She further narrates the incident said, “One night, he’d beaten me so much that I had a fractured jaw. He took his father’s picture and warned me saying I swear on my father that I will kill you tonight. When he turned back to keep the photo frame back, in that fraction of a second, my mom’s voice echoed in my ears that at such a moment you will have to run - bas bhaag, mat soch ki kapde pehne hai ya nahi, paise hain ya nahi, bas bhaag.” Flora also shared how the police had at first refused to file her complaint and were talking to her ex on the phone and telling him that she had come to file a complaint. But eventually, she was able to file a handwritten complaint against her ex-boyfriend.

On the work front, Flora Saini has appeared in Hindi films like Love In Nepal, Dabangg 2, Lakshmi and Dhanak. Among her other roles, Flora is known for playing a ghost in Stree. Recently, a sequel to the 2018 film was announced.
